Output a52338963da901bae361e86c3fc40e51ecc984a968b108cc180d6a7189e51546:0

value
726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31a1839b96d4ff310bad56ba9a3142a46dec480c OP_EQUAL
address
36DSX933JymHw1WRdXXuLZ2tXmv2iFqnrw
transaction
a52338963da901bae361e86c3fc40e51ecc984a968b108cc180d6a7189e51546
confirmations
286972
spent
true